Dissertation Title:

“The United States, Russia, and the Post-Cold War Security Order, 1992-2000"

Holly’s dissertation examines U.S. foreign relations with Russia in the 1990s, a time of significant political and economic change after the end of the Soviet Union. She is interested in how policymakers understood and implemented the relationship as part of a much larger effort to construct a post-Cold War international system, which included the UN, NATO, G8, APEC, and the IMF.
